Olav Berstad

Olav Berstad (born 19 September 1953) is a Norwegian diplomat.

He was born in Tromsø, and is a cand.mag. by education. He started working for the Norwegian Ministry of Foreign Affairs in 1980. After serving as sub-director from 1996 to 1998, he was the Norwegian ambassador to Azerbaijan from 1998 to 2001, [1] [2] [3] and to Ukraine from 2006 to 2011. Since May 2013 he has been the board chair of Tangen V home owner's association in Nesodden, Akershus, Norway. [4]
